Description

Desktop loudspeaker box
Technical Field
The utility model relates to the technical field of household electronic products, in particular to a desktop sound box.
Background
Desktop speakers and alarm clocks are common household electronic products; the desktop sound box can be placed on a desktop, a bookshelf and a cabinet and can be connected with sound sources such as a mobile phone and a computer in a wired or wireless mode, so that the sound is amplified for the sound sources and the sound quality is improved; the alarm clock can also be placed on a desktop, a bookshelf and a cabinet for indicating time and providing an alarm.
Desktop speakers with clock function have appeared, and such products usually have a screen for displaying time and other information, which needs to be always facing the user during normal use in order for the user to obtain time information.
In order to enable the desktop sound box to have a more dazzling visual appearance effect, manufacturers often add a breathing lamp on the desktop sound box to provide lighting effect of the breathing lamp; however, in the desktop sound box in the prior art, the breathing lamp often surrounds the whole desktop sound box, and after the screen is arranged on the desktop sound box, a user faces the screen to himself in order to watch the screen, so that the lighting effect of the breathing lamp surrounding the whole desktop sound box cannot be observed by the user completely.

Detailed Description

Referring to fig. 1-3, a desktop speaker includes a main mounting frame 1, a front housing assembly 2, a rear housing 3, a main circuit board 4 and a speaker 5.
The main mounting frame 1 is a half shell made of engineering plastic, and a plurality of mounting columns 11 with internal threads are arranged on the closed surface of the main mounting frame for locking screws; the rear shell 3 is also a half shell made of engineering plastic, a plurality of threaded hole sites with internal threads are arranged in the rear shell for locking screws, and one side of the rear shell 3 is provided with an opening; the loudspeaker 5 is a cone type loudspeaker 5, the loudspeaker 5 is in a circular basin shape, the edge of the loudspeaker is a thin basin frame, and the basin frame is provided with mounting lugs with screw holes; the main circuit board 4 is a Printed Circuit Board (PCB), and the main control is mounted on the main circuit board 4.
A screen 41 and a plurality of lamp beads 42 are mounted on the main circuit board 4, specifically, a display driving chip is mounted on the main circuit board 4, the screen 41 is a liquid crystal screen module or an LED screen module with backlight, the screen 41 is in signal connection with the display driving chip through a printed circuit on the main circuit board 4, the display driving chip is also in signal connection with a main control signal through a printed circuit on the main circuit board 4, in this embodiment, the screen 41 is a dot matrix LED screen module; the lamp beads 42 are colored LED lamp beads, the lamp beads 42 are carried on the main circuit board 4 in a surface mounting mode, a plurality of lamp beads 42 are arranged around the center of the main circuit board 4 in the circumferential direction, and all the lamp beads 42 are electrically connected with a main controller through printed circuits on the main circuit board 4; the main circuit board 4 is fixed on the main mounting frame 1, namely, the main circuit board 4 is fixed on the mounting column 11 of the main mounting frame 1 through a screw; the main circuit board 4, the main mounting frame 1 and the loudspeaker 5 are all accommodated in the rear shell 3, and the screen 41 of the main circuit board 4 faces the opening of the rear shell 3, specifically, screws pass through mounting lugs on a frame of the loudspeaker 5 and are locked into threaded hole positions of the rear shell 3, so that the loudspeaker 5 is fixed in the rear shell 3, the main mounting frame 1 is also fixed in the rear shell 3 through screws, at the moment, the main circuit board 4 is accommodated in the rear shell 3 together with the main mounting frame 1, and the screen 41 faces the opening of the rear shell 3, and further, the main mounting frame 1 covers the loudspeaker 5, so that the loudspeaker 5 is protected; the speaker 5 is electrically and signal-connected to the main circuit board 4, in this embodiment, the speaker 5 leads out a lead with a connector and is connected to the main circuit board 4, so as to electrically and signal-connect the speaker 5 to the main circuit board 4.
The main circuit board 4 is provided with a bluetooth module, so that the main circuit board 4 can acquire an audio signal from a sound source and play the audio signal through the loudspeaker 5, and in addition, the loudspeaker 5 also has the function of alarm clock ringing. The screen 41 of the main circuit board 4 can display information such as time, a play song, and the like.
The front shell assembly 2 comprises a front shell 21 and a light guide shell 22, wherein the front shell 21 is a semitransparent engineering plastic cover body, such as opalescent or grayish black semitransparent acrylic, and the light guide shell 22 is a transparent engineering plastic cover body and has good light guide performance; the front shell 21 is sequentially provided with an inner mounting part 213 and a light guide part 211 from inside to outside, the light guide part 211 is annular and surrounds the inner mounting part 213, a screen hole 214 matched with the shape of the screen 41 is formed in the inner mounting part 213, namely, the screen 41 on the main circuit board 4 can pass through the screen hole 214; the front shell 21 covers the opening of the rear shell 3 to cover the main mounting frame 1, the screen 41 of the main circuit board 4 penetrates out of the screen hole 214 of the front shell 21, specifically, an outer mounting part 212 is formed at the edge of the front shell 21, and the outer mounting part 212 is buckled with the opening of the rear shell 3, in this embodiment, the outer mounting part 212 is arranged along the axial direction of the front shell 21, a clamping hole is formed in the outer mounting part 212, a clamping jaw matched with the clamping hole is formed on the inner wall of the rear shell 3, the outer mounting part 212 of the front shell 21 is pressed into the opening of the rear shell 3, so that the clamping jaw of the rear shell 3 is clamped into the clamping hole of the outer mounting part 212, the front shell 21 and the rear shell 3 are fixed with each other, and at the moment, the screen 41 of the main circuit board 4 penetrates out of the screen hole 214 of the front shell 21; the light guide shell 22 is disposed between the main circuit board 4 and the front shell 21 to guide the light of the lamp beads 42 on the main circuit board 4 to the light guide portion 211 of the front shell 21, in this embodiment, the light guide shell 22 is annular and is clamped by the main circuit board 4 and the front shell 21, the light emitting surface of the lamp beads 42 on the circuit board faces the light guide shell 22, one surface of the light guide shell 22 is tightly attached to the inner wall of the front shell 21, so as to guide the light of the lamp beads 42 on the main circuit board 4 to the light guide portion 211 of the front shell 21.
The lamp beads 42 are set to be colored breathing lamps, after the lamp beads 42 are lighted, the lamp light can be irradiated on the light guide shell 22, the light guide shell 22 effectively conducts and diffuses the lamp light of the lamp beads 42, and the lamp light is transmitted out of the light guide portion 211 after being fully distributed on the light guide portion 211 of the front shell 21, so that a circle of annular breathing lamp light effect is formed at the light guide portion 211 of the front shell 21.
Further, the front case assembly 2 further includes a semi-transparent panel 23, the semi-transparent panel 23 being fixed on the inner mounting portion 213 of the front case 21 and covering the screen 41; specifically, the semi-permeable panel 23 is a circular semi-permeable Polycarbonate (PC) plate, and the semi-permeable panel 23 is fixed to the inner mounting portion 213 of the front case 21 by an adhesive; when the screen 41 is not bright after the assembly is completed, the semi-transparent panel 23 covers the screen 41 and the inner mounting part 213 of the front shell 21, and the front surface of the semi-transparent panel 23 is a whole panel when viewed from the outside; after the screen 41 is lighted, the lighted part is transmitted out of the semi-transparent panel 23, a user can see the lighted part of the screen 41 through the semi-transparent panel 23, and the front surface of the semi-transparent panel 23 is a whole display panel when seen from the outside; the semi-transparent panel 23 is arranged, so that the desktop loudspeaker box is more attractive.
Further, a plurality of sound holes 32 are formed in the rear housing 3, and the sound emitting surface of the speaker 5 is aligned with the sound holes 32, so that the speaker 5 can emit sound conveniently.
Further, the main circuit board 4 is mounted with a first switch 43, specifically, the first switch 43 is a micro switch, the first switch 43 is mounted on the main circuit board 4 in a plug-in manner, and the first switch 43 is connected with the main control signal through a printed circuit on the main circuit board 4, and after the first switch 43 is triggered, the control functions of turning on and off the machine, adjusting the volume of the speaker 5, switching the music, adjusting the time and setting the alarm clock, for example, can be completed; the first button 24 is arranged at the inner mounting part 213 of the front shell 21 in a penetrating manner, the first button 24 is made of rubber or silica gel, the first button 24 and the first switch 43 on the main circuit board 4 are aligned with each other, and the first switch 43 can be triggered when the first button 24 is pressed.
Further, the desktop sound box further comprises a key circuit board 6, wherein the key circuit board 6 is provided with a second switch 61, in this embodiment, the key circuit board 6 is a Printed Circuit Board (PCB), the second switch 61 is a micro switch, and the second switch 61 is provided on the key circuit board 6 in a plug-in shape; the key circuit board 6 is accommodated in the rear shell 3, and in the embodiment, the key circuit board 6 is fixed on the main mounting frame 1 and accommodated in the rear shell 3 together with the main mounting frame 1; a second key 31 penetrates through the rear shell 3, in this embodiment, the second key 31 is made of rubber or silica gel, the second key 31 and a second switch 61 on the key circuit board 6 are aligned with each other, and the second switch 61 can be triggered when the second key 31 is pressed down; key circuit board 6 and main circuit board 4 signal connection, in this embodiment, key circuit board 6 and main circuit board 4 realize electric connection and signal connection through the winding displacement, trigger the second switch 61 back through pressing second button 31, can accomplish for example the switch on and off, speaker 5 volume control, switch song, adjust time and set up the control function of alarm clock.
Further, the desktop sound box further comprises a power circuit board 7, a direct current input interface 71 and a charging interface 72 are mounted on the power circuit board 7, wherein the power circuit board 7 is a Printed Circuit Board (PCB) on which a power supply control chip is mounted, the direct current input interface 71 is a 5V or 3.3V direct current input port, the charging interface 72 is a USB output interface, the direct current input interface 71 and the charging interface 72 are mounted on the power circuit board 7 in a plug-in manner, and the direct current input interface 71 and the charging interface 72 are both electrically connected with the power supply control chip to control input of the direct current input interface 71 and output of the charging interface 72; the power circuit board 7 is accommodated in the rear shell 3, and the direct current input interface 71 and the charging interface 72 respectively penetrate out of the rear shell 3, in this embodiment, the power circuit board 7 is accommodated in a space at the bottom of the rear shell 3 and fixed in the rear shell 3 through screws, and the direct current input interface 71 and the charging interface 72 respectively penetrate out of the rear end of the rear shell 3; the power circuit board 7 is electrically connected to the main circuit board 4, and in this embodiment, the power circuit board 7 is electrically connected to the main circuit board 4 through a flat cable and is in signal connection. An external direct-current power supply is connected through a direct-current input interface 71 to supply power for the desktop sound box; through the charging interface 72, the external electronic product can be charged.
According to the desktop sound box, the screen 41 of the main circuit board 4 penetrates out of the screen hole 214 of the front shell 21, and the light guide shell 22 guides the light of the lamp bead 42 on the main circuit board 4 to the light guide part 211 of the front shell 21, so that when the desktop sound box faces a user, the screen 41 and the breath light of the desktop sound box are located on the same surface, can be observed by the user at the same time, and have a good visual effect.
